Factors Influencing Plant Location

Choosing where to manufacture a vehicle like the Honda HR-V is far more strategic than just finding an available factory space. Honda carefully considers multiple factors to ensure production efficiency, cost-effectiveness, and market responsiveness.

Proximity to Major Markets

One of the primary factors influencing Honda’s plant locations is the proximity to key consumer markets. Producing vehicles closer to where they will be sold reduces shipping costs and delivery times, ultimately allowing Honda to respond faster to market demand. For example, Honda manufactures HR-V models in plants across different regions—including North America, Asia, and other parts of the world—to serve local markets efficiently.

Access to Skilled Labor and Suppliers

Another critical factor is access to a skilled workforce and a network of suppliers. Manufacturing an HR-V requires precision engineering and assembly, which depends on trained workers familiar with Honda’s quality standards. Additionally, locating plants near parts suppliers streamlines the supply chain, reduces delays, and helps maintain consistent quality.

Economic and Political Stability

Honda also evaluates economic incentives, political stability, and trade policies when deciding plant locations. Countries or regions that offer favorable tax breaks, investment incentives, and stable regulatory environments make for attractive manufacturing hubs. This approach helps Honda manage costs and mitigate risks associated with global manufacturing.

Infrastructure and Logistics

Efficient infrastructure—like highways, ports, and rail networks—is essential to support the movement of parts and finished vehicles. Honda’s plant sites are typically chosen with logistics in mind, ensuring smooth operations and timely deliveries to dealerships and customers.

Local Market Adaptation

Manufacturing the HR-V isn’t a one-size-fits-all process. Honda understands that each region’s market has unique preferences, regulations, and conditions. This insight drives how Honda adapts its manufacturing and vehicle features to local needs.

Tailoring Features and Specifications

For instance, HR-V models built for the North American market might have different engine options, safety features, or infotainment systems compared to models sold in Asia or Europe. Honda’s manufacturing plants incorporate these variations, ensuring that each HR-V aligns with local consumer expectations and legal requirements.

Responding to Consumer Preferences

Local adaptation goes beyond features—it includes manufacturing flexibility to respond quickly to shifts in demand. If a particular color, trim, or accessory becomes popular in one region, Honda’s production lines can adjust to meet those preferences without significant delays.

Meeting Regional Regulations

Environmental and safety regulations can vary widely from one market to another. Honda’s plants integrate compliance measures, such as emissions controls and safety standards, directly into the manufacturing process. This localized approach helps Honda meet and exceed regional regulatory demands, which is essential for maintaining market trust and brand reputation.

Sustainability and Innovation in Manufacturing

In today’s world, sustainability isn’t just an option—it’s a necessity. Honda embraces this reality by embedding innovative and eco-friendly practices into the HR-V’s manufacturing process.

Energy Efficiency and Waste Reduction

Honda’s manufacturing plants use advanced technologies to reduce energy consumption and minimize waste. From optimizing assembly line efficiency to implementing recycling programs for materials, the company continuously looks for ways to lessen its environmental footprint.

Many Honda factories have adopted renewable energy sources, like solar power, and employ energy management systems that monitor and improve efficiency in real-time. This dedication helps lower carbon emissions and supports Honda’s global sustainability goals.

Use of Sustainable Materials

Beyond the manufacturing floor, Honda explores sustainable materials in the HR-V itself. Some parts are made using recycled or bio-based materials, reflecting a commitment to reducing the environmental impact from start to finish.

Smart Manufacturing and Automation

Innovation also means smarter manufacturing. Honda integrates robotics and automation to improve precision and consistency while freeing human workers to focus on quality control and complex tasks. This blend of technology and craftsmanship helps maintain Honda’s reputation for durability and reliability.

Moreover, Honda employs data analytics and AI to predict maintenance needs, streamline production schedules, and reduce downtime, all of which contribute to a more sustainable and efficient operation.
